KVM虚拟机网络设置rtl8139,KVM虚拟机网络配置指南,详解rtl8139网卡设置
- 综合资讯
- 2024-12-12 08:51:19
- 2

本文详细介绍了KVM虚拟机网络设置,以rtl8139网卡为例,提供了完整的网络配置指南,帮助用户快速设置KVM虚拟机网络。...
本文详细介绍了KVM虚拟机网络设置,以rtl8139网卡为例,提供了完整的网络配置指南,帮助用户快速设置KVM虚拟机网络。
KVM(Kernel-based Virtual Machine)是一款基于Linux内核的虚拟化技术,具有高性能、稳定性强、资源利用率高等优点,在KVM虚拟机中,网络配置是至关重要的环节,它直接影响到虚拟机的网络通信,本文将详细介绍如何根据KVM虚拟机网络设置rtl8139网卡,帮助您快速搭建稳定的虚拟网络环境。
rtl8139网卡简介
rtl8139网卡是一款较为常见的网络适配器,具有较好的兼容性和稳定性,在KVM虚拟机中,通过配置rtl8139网卡,可以确保虚拟机具有良好的网络性能。
KVM虚拟机网络设置步骤
1、确保物理主机已安装rtl8139网卡驱动
在物理主机上,需要确保已安装rtl8139网卡驱动,不同Linux发行版安装驱动的方法可能略有差异,以下以CentOS 7为例:
(1)打开终端,输入以下命令安装rtl8139网卡驱动:
sudo yum install kmod-r8169
(2)重启系统,使驱动生效。
2、创建虚拟机
使用KVM创建虚拟机时,选择rtl8139网卡作为网络适配器,以下以qemu-kvm为例,创建一个名为“test”的虚拟机,并设置rtl8139网卡:
(1)打开终端,输入以下命令创建虚拟机配置文件:
qemu-img create -f qcow2 test.img 20G
(2)创建虚拟机XML配置文件:
virt-install --name test --ram 1024 --vcpus 1 --disk path=/var/lib/libvirt/images/test.img,size=20 --os-type linux --os-variant fedora32 --network network=default,model=virtio --graphics none
(3)启动虚拟机:
virsh start test
3、配置虚拟机网络
(1)查看虚拟机网络设备:
virsh domifaddr test
(2)配置虚拟机网络接口:
以CentOS 7为例,编辑虚拟机的网络配置文件:
sudo vi /etc/sysconfig/network-scripts/ifcfg-eth0
修改配置文件内容如下:
DEVICE=eth0 BOOTPROTO=none ONBOOT=yes TYPE=Ethernet I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1
(3)重启网络服务:
sudo systemctl restart network
4、测试网络连接
在虚拟机中,使用ping命令测试网络连接:
ping 192.168.1.1
如果能够正常ping通网关,则说明虚拟机网络配置成功。
本文详细介绍了如何根据KVM虚拟机网络设置rtl8139网卡,通过以上步骤,您可以在KVM虚拟机中配置稳定、高效的网络环境,在实际应用中,您可以根据需求调整网络配置,以满足不同场景下的网络需求。
本文链接:https://www.zhitaoyun.cn/1503138.html
发表评论